Description
Amber Valley Borough Council is seeking Expressions of Interest from suitably experienced companies wishing to provide a quotation to undertake the first stage of an audio-visual upgrade of its Council Chamber. In the first stage the successful company will be required to provide and install linked wireless microphone units that must be capable of integrating into Council meetings and providing the Chairperson or Democratic Services Officer to effectively control meetings, via a press to queue system and by control over which microphones are live, with integrated screens to assist delegate participation.
The system must be capable of integrating with the Council's existing hearing loop system and include a small number of standalone microphones to enable public speaking where appropriate.
The delegate microphones must also be capable of delegate recognition via RFID or similar. The system must also be capable of being easily upgraded in future to enable the introduction of electronic voting, through either licencing or a software upgrade, as well as automatically panning cameras.
